The document discusses mechanics of solid deflection in beams. It provides relationships between bending moment and curvature, as well as sign conventions for shear force, bending moment, slope and deflection. It then analyzes simply supported beams with central point loads and uniform distributed loads. Equations are derived for slope, deflection and bending moment at any section. Cantilevers with point loads and uniform distributed loads are also analyzed. Macaulay's method, a versatile technique for determining slope and deflection in beams under various loading conditions, is introduced. Examples applying the concepts to specific beam problems are included.
